21 to 3 and 6 factors each equal to 5. Sometimes 34x50 is more briefly denoted by 34.56. 7. PROB. To find the quotient of two numbers which consist of one or of two digits. Let it be required to find the quotient arising from 15 divided by 5. The quotient denotes the number of times the divisor is contained in, or can be subtracted from, the dividend. Let 5 be subtracted successively from 15. First. 5 subtracted from 15 leaves 10. Secondly. 5 from 10 leaves 5. Thirdly. 5 from 5 leaves 0. So that 5 can be subtracted 3 times from 15, or 5 is; contained 3 times in 15, or 15 divided by 5 gives 3 for the quotient. This will also appear from the fact that division being the reverse of multiplication, since 3 times a is 15, it follows that 5 is contained 3 times in 15. PROB. To divide any number by a number of one digit. The process depends on the following Axiom. One number is contained in another as many times as the former is contained in the several parts into which the latter can be divided.
